Why Is Automation So Important?

As your online store grows, manually processing orders, managing inventory, and launching marketing campaigns becomes increasingly resource-intensive, especially when competitors are hot on your heels, and your budget and personnel are limited. At the same time, Shopify integrations allow you to:

  • Save your team’s time since automation tools allow its members to process orders, update product balances, and set up mailings in just a few clicks;
  • Reduce the number of human errors, which means the likelihood that orders will go to the wrong customers, prices will be incorrect, and deliveries will be late will be negligible;
  • Boost the results of marketing campaigns through personalization and the creation of individual product selections based on previous order history and user likes;
  • Improve customer service by implementing chatbots that independently generate answers to frequently asked questions, as well as integrating online stores with CRM systems that store all personal customer data.

Shopify Integrations for Automation That Are Worth Your Attention

Generally speaking, the Shopify App Store has over 8,000 apps, among which you will definitely find solutions for automating your most priority business tasks.

Image2

In particular, the following ones can be attributed to them.

Order processing and logistics

Here, first of all, it is worth paying attention to such solutions as ShipStation (for automating label printing, simple management of order delivery, and their tracking), Easyship (for quick calculation of shipping costs and connecting international delivery services such as DHL, FedEx, and UPS), as well as Shopify Fulfillment Network (to organize order storing processes and automatic their sending).

Warehouse management

When it comes to warehouse management, integrations such as Stock Sync (for automatically updating product balances on third-party marketplaces such as Amazon, eBay, and Google Shopping), SkuVault (for managing warehouse stocks and automating purchasing processes), and Orderhive (for real-time monitoring of product balances to eliminate shortages or surpluses) can come to your aid.

Launching marketing campaigns and email newsletters

If we are talking about digital marketing, tools like Klaviyo (an email and SMS marketing solution that allows you to set up automated sending of personalized offers), Omnisend (for automating emails to create triggered email chains for repeat sales), and Recart (for recovering abandoned carts via communication channels like email, SMS, and instant messaging) will come in handy.

Advertising and retargeting

The most popular integrations automating tasks related to this category include Facebook & Instagram Shopping (for running product ads on social networks), Google Shopping (for seamless integration with Google Ads to display ads in search and shopping campaigns), and Shopify Audiences (an advanced AI tool for finding new customers through ads).

Customer service

With customer inquiries, you can benefit from such advanced solutions from the Shopify App Store as Gorgias (a comprehensive CRM platform for automating responses to customer requests via email, online chats, and social networks), Tidio (an AI chatbot for consultations and customer support without the involvement of live personnel), and Yotpo (for automatic collection of reviews and publishing UGC content).

Cash flow management and accounting

Finally, the most fully functional integrations from this group include QuickBooks Commerce (for real-time sales accounting, tax calculation, and accounting), Xero (for integration with banking services and payment systems), and TaxJar (for calculating taxes for different regions and maintaining financial reports).
